AFU Faisalabad confiscates contraband mobile phones, watches, other items

FAISALABAD: The Customs Air Freight Unit Faisalabad has seized more than 24 pieces of smuggling cellular phones and wrist watches at the Faisalabad International Airport during a checking of Dubai Airways flight No: FDB- 323.

The AFU customs team, under the supervision of Assistant Collector Shah Samand Hamadani, comprising Inspectors Muhammad Yousaf, Abdul Nasir, Farhan Frank and Sepoy Muhammad Yar, intercepted a passenger named Shah Ali son of Muhammad Yaqoob, a resident of Rasoolpura, district Jhang, having CNIC No: 37405-5364098-5, and scanned and checked his baggage. One bag was found suspicious and was opened in the presence of two witnesses which led to the recovery of foreign origin mobile phones, wrist watches, mobile chargers and hand-frees of different brands.

The customs team asked the passenger to show any relevant receipt or invoices but he failed to provide any of the documents. During the checking, the customs team found mobile set Samsung mobiles 7-Nos, LG mobile 1-Nos, Leeno mobiles 5-Nos, infix mobiles 5-Nos, Tel mobiles 3-Nos, wrist watches 19-Nos Citizen China, watches 5-Nos of unknown brand, hand-free Samsung 35-Nos, Charger assorted brand 12-Nos of different brands. The AFU impounded all the items under Section 168 of the Customs Act-1969. The value of these items was estimated at Rs114272 involving customs duty of Rs56839.
